Ghunsa people leave settlement to avoid severe cold
Ghunsa people leave settlement to avoid severe cold
PHINGLING, Jan 22: People at Ghunsa village of Phattanglung Rural Municipality-6 in Taplejung district have left the settlement to avoid the cold in the wake of snowfall. Seven households left their homes and reached Kathmandu, while four others shifted to district headquarter Phungling bazar.

Trade through Tatopani suspended for 20 days
Trade through Tatopani suspended for 20 days
SINDHUPALCHOWK, Jan 22: Trade through the Tatopani border point in the north has been closed for the next 20 days. The decision to suspend all trade activities for 20 days was taken after the maintenance of the Miteri Bridge connecting Nepal and China commenced on Thursday.
